Schererville, IN Radon Facts
Located in Lake County within the Chicago Metro area, Schererville shows an average radon level of 7.5 pCi/L based on local testing data. This reading significantly exceeds the EPA's 4.0 pCi/L action threshold, reflecting the area's glacial geology and typical basement construction. Homeowners in zip code 46375 should test their properties and consider mitigation systems where elevated levels are confirmed.
Based on 2 user-submitted radon tests for homes in Schererville, IN. The EPA recommends taking action at or above 4.0 pCi/L.
